Overview:

Overview

This role will directly support Sentara Health's strategic initiatives by:

Enhancing Data Literacy: Empower staff at all levels to make data-driven decisions using Cogito's suite of tools.

Improving Tool Adoption: Ensure effective use of Epic's analytics tools across the organization, improving workflows and decision-making processes.

Standardizing Training: Reduce variability in the understanding and use of Epic's analytics tools, ensuring consistency across teams and maximizing the value of the investment.

Key Responsibilities:

1. Curriculum Development - Design and update role-based training materials for Epic's Cogito tools, ensuring content is aligned with the needs of all Epic users: to include Sentara Health and all Epic Community Connect partner sites.

2. Training Delivery - Deliver engaging virtual and in-person training sessions for end-users, super-users, and "train-the-trainer" programs.

3. Collaboration with Stakeholders - Work closely with operational leaders and analytics teams to ensure that training content is timely, relevant, and meets the organization's business needs.

4. Training Environment Management - Collaborate with Epic Application Principal trainers to oversee the maintenance and synchronization of the Epic training environment (MST) with production systems, ensuring training materials reflect real-world scenarios.

5. User Support - Provide ongoing support through troubleshooting, one-on-one coaching, and follow-up sessions to ensure users continue to improve their skills post-training.

6. Feedback to Development Teams - Act as a conduit for feedback from training sessions, ensuring insights are communicated to development teams to refine and improve content.

7. Development of Asynchronous Training Materials - Create and update job aids, "how-to" guides, and asynchronous materials to complement live training and provide continuous learning resources.

8. Promote Standard Solutions - Advocate for the use of standardized solutions to ensure consistency in the application of Epic's analytics tools across the organization.

Education
  • Bachelor's Degree (Preferred)
Certification/Licensure
  • Epic Cogito Fundamentals (COG 170) (Preferred)
  • Cogito Principal Trainer (TED 105) (Preferred)
  • Epic Training Environment Build (TED 300) (Preferred)
Experience
  • Epic Application build support - minimum 2 years, in the previous 5 years, supporting build for any Epic application
  • 3-5 years in instructional design, teaching, or training, preferably within healthcare IT or clinical applications.
  • Proven ability to design and deliver training programs based on adult learning principles, tailored to diverse audiences, from clinicians to data analysts.
